Old Library Theatre presents "Titantic, the Musical"
 

(FAIR LAWN, NJ) -- Old Library Theatre (OLT), Fair Lawn Recreation Department's resident theatre company, will present Titantic, the Musical, over two weekends, October 13-22, 2023. Featuring music and lyrics by Maury Yeston and a book by Peter Stone, won five Tony awards in 1997, including Best Musical. Although it opened the same year as James Cameron's film of the same name, the two works are not related.

Philharmonic of Southern New Jersey's New Music Director to Open 2023-24 Season with Brahms, Elgar
 

(VOORHEES, NJ) -- The 85+ members of the all-volunteer Philharmonic of Southern New Jersey will take the stage to open the PSNJ's 2023-24 season on Sunday, October 15, 2023 as the group welcomes James Allen Anderson as its new Music Director. During this first performance of the season, the PSNJ will offer two iconic works from the symphonic repertoire: Edward Elgar's Enigma Variations and Symphony No. 4 in E minor, Op. 98 by Johannes Brahms. The two works explore the "Theme and Variation" musical form and Anderson selected the works for their beauty and timelessness.

Fall 2023 New Jersey Film Festival Winners Announced!
 

Fall 2023 New Jersey Film Festival Winners    ​​​​​​​All the works that were part of the Fall 2023 New Jersey Film Festival Competition were selected by a panel of judges including media professionals, journalists, students, and academics. These judges selected the 19 finalists which were publicly screened at our Festival. The finalists were selected from 403 works submitted by filmmakers from around the world. In addition, the judges chose the Prize Winners in conjunction with the Festival Director.
